There are many adult ADHD special services available in the UK. They are usually located in hospitals such as the Maudsley and are funded by NHS England. However, they are not available everywhere in the country and waiting lists can be extremely long.

In addition, Psychiatry-UK can now offer NHS paid assessments and medications through the Right To Choose scheme. This is where patients can choose their clinically appropriate provider in line with current guidelines. Psychiatry UK has contracts with ICBCs (ICBCs) in England to provide these NHS funded ADHD assessments and treatments. Find out more information about this here.

Assessment

If you're concerned that might be suffering from ADHD the first step should be to speak with your GP. They should take you concerns seriously and ask to fill out a screening form to determine whether you have adhd assessment Uk Private or any other mental health issues. If you meet the requirements and are diagnosed, you will be sent to a clinic. NHS clinics can be overcrowded, so it is important to know how long you might need to wait for an appointment.

The test is typically conducted by a psychiatrist, however it could also be performed by psychologists. It is essential to determine if the provider you're considering is certified. The typical ADHD assessment will last about an hour. It will comprise the history of your psychiatric and medical conditions as well as an assessment of your current symptoms. It is recommended to bring someone with you during the assessment. However it is not required.

After the exam, your doctor will determine if have ADHD and, if so the level of ADHD you are suffering from. They will then advise you on what you should do next. They may prescribe medication but they may also discuss other options such as cognitive behavioral treatment.

If your doctor concludes that you suffer from ADHD They will issue you a formal diagnosis. If your doctor does not decide to prescribe medication for you and explains the reasons. It is important to keep in mind that you have the right to refuse treatment and decide to seek an additional opinion.
